Meaning
High temperature lithium batteries are advanced energy storage devices designed to operate in extreme temperature environments, ranging from -20°C to 200°C or higher. Unlike conventional lithium-ion batteries, which experience performance degradation and safety risks at elevated temperatures, high temperature lithium batteries utilize specialized electrolytes, electrode materials, and packaging designs to withstand thermal stress and maintain stable performance. These batteries offer higher energy density, faster charging rates, and longer cycle life, making them suitable for demanding applications where temperature fluctuations are common.

Category-wise Insights
- Lithium Iron Phosphate (LiFePO4): LiFePO4 batteries are known for their high thermal stability, long cycle life, and safety features, making them suitable for high temperature applications in electric vehicles, renewable energy storage, and industrial automation.
- Lithium Nickel Cobalt Aluminum Oxide (NCA): NCA batteries offer high energy density, fast charging rates, and thermal stability, making them ideal for high temperature environments in electric vehicles, aerospace applications, and consumer electronics.
- Lithium Nickel Manganese Cobalt Oxide (NMC): NMC batteries combine high energy density, power capability, and thermal stability, making them versatile for high temperature applications in electric vehicles, renewable energy systems, and industrial automation.
- Lithium Titanate Oxide (LTO): LTO batteries are known for their fast charging rates, long cycle life, and thermal stability, making them suitable for high temperature applications in electric vehicles, stationary energy storage, and industrial automation.
